About Elaine M. Blinde

Elaine M. Blinde is a scholar working on Gender Studies, Physical Therapy, Sports Therapy and Rehabilitation and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ology, having authored 33 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sports, Gender, and Society (20 papers), Sport and Mega-Event Impacts (12 papers) and Sports Analytics and Performance (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Physical Therapy, Sports Therapy and Rehabilitation (187 citations), Gender Studies (367 citations) and Safety Research (310 citations). Elaine M. Blinde has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Diane E. Taub, Sarah G. McCallister, Susan L. Greendorfer, Windee M. Weiss, Kimberly R. Greer, Diane M. Samdahl, Douglas A. Kleiber, James Tierney and Lijin Han. Their work appears in journals such as Human Relations, Psychosomatics and Research Quarterly for Exercise and Sport.
